About The Company
At MML Hospitality, we are more than a collection of restaurants, hotels, and shops. We are a passionate team dedicated to crafting unforgettable experiences that celebrate the essence of our hometown, Austin, Texas. Founded by Larry McGuire and Tom Moorman Jr. in 2006, we set out to elevate simple barbecue in a beautifully designed space. Today, we’re a multi-faceted hospitality group with a commitment to excellence, creativity, and the neighborhoods we call home. Liz Lambert joined us in 2020, adding visionary leadership and expertise to our growing family.

About June’s All Day 

A little bit of Paris is coming to Dallas.

June’s All Day is expanding to Dallas! Known for its vibrant atmosphere, curated wine list, and crave-worthy bistro menu, June’s transitions seamlessly from morning coffee and weekend brunch to late-night dinner. We are looking for an ambitious, highly skilled Executive Chef to lead our kitchen opening, build a top-tier culinary team, and execute our scratch menu with absolute consistency.

Key Responsibilities

  • Culinary Execution: Oversee and execute an all-day menu (Lunch, Brunch, and Dinner) featuring French bistro classics and modern favorites made with high-quality ingredients.
     
  • BOH Leadership: Recruit, train, and mentor line cooks, prep cooks, and dishwashers—building a positive, disciplined kitchen culture from day one.
     
  • Financial Oversight: Manage food and labor costs, control inventory, maintain vendor partnerships, and drive BOH profitability.
     
  • Kitchen Operations: Supervise prep, line execution, and plating during high-volume rushes to guarantee speed and quality control.
     
  • Safety & Sanitation: Enforce strict health department compliance, sanitation practices, and kitchen organization.
     

Qualifications & Requirements 

  • 6+ years as an Executive Chef or Head Chef in a high-volume, scratch-kitchen environment.
     
  • Deep understanding of bistro cuisine, modern prep techniques, food costing, and kitchen financials.
     
  • Proven leadership ability with a track record of building and retaining strong kitchen teams.
     
  • Certified Texas Food Manager.
